As summarized in the Annual Corrective Action <br />Evaluation prepared by Herst & Associates (2006), the overall groundwater quality at the <br />site is improving. <br />3.1.6 Domestic Well Monitoring <br />Two domestic wells (7898-A and 8106-A) were sampled on November 15, 2005. Table <br />3-3 summarizes the current analytical results for the domestic well samples collected. As <br />shown on Table 3-3 and excluding suspected lab contaminants, two VOCs were <br />measured in the sample from domestic well 7898-A with all three VOCs (PCE and TCE) <br />measured above the PQL, while five VOCs were measured in the sample from domestic <br />well 8106-A with three VOCs (DCDFM, PCE, and TCE) measured above the PQL. <br />3.1.7 Surface Water Monitoring <br />Surface water samples were collected on November 28, 2006, at surface water <br />monitoring stations ASW -1 and ASW -2. Table 3-4 summarizes the current analytical <br />results for surface water samples collected at the Austin Unit and compares the results <br />with the WQPS (concentration limits). Excluding suspected laboratory contaminants, no <br />VOCs were detected at the surface water monitoring stations during the fourth quarter <br />2006 monitoring period. In addition, Herst & Associates calculated CLs and trend <br />analyses for the surface water monitoring stations (Appendix D). During the fourth <br />quarter 2006 monitoring period no CLs were exceeded at downgradient surface water <br />station ASW -2. <br />3.1.8 Leachate Monitoring <br />According to the Operations Manager, no leachate was taken off site during the fourth • <br />quarter 2006.
